Mysql R39-2 Don't save - Printable Version
+- SA-MP Forums Archive (
https://sampforum.blast.hk)
+-- Forum: SA-MP Scripting and Plugins (
https://sampforum.blast.hk/forumdisplay.php?fid=8)
+--- Forum: Scripting Help (
https://sampforum.blast.hk/forumdisplay.php?fid=12)
+--- Thread: Mysql R39-2 Don't save (
/showthread.php?tid=561150)
Mysql R39-2 Don't save -
BreakStore - 01.02.2015
Hello,
I have a problem, my stats mysql don't save on the database on the deconnection :
Script :
OnplayerDisconnect :
PHP код:
new query[128], Float:pos[3];
GetPlayerPos(playerid,pos[0],pos[1],pos[2]);
mysql_format(mysql,query,sizeof(query),"UPDATE `comptejoueurs` SET `Admin`=%d, `Vip`=%d, `Argent`=%d, `PositionX`=%f, `PositionY`=%f, `PositionZ`=%f WHERE `ID`=%d",\
InfoJoueur[playerid][Admin],InfoJoueur[playerid][Vip],InfoJoueur[playerid][Argent],pos[0],pos[1],pos[2], InfoJoueur[playerid][ID]);
mysql_tquery(mysql,query,"","");
printf("%s",query);
Thanks
Re: Mysql R39-2 Don't save -
amirab - 01.02.2015
i tested that , try this instead maybe it works :
PHP код:
new query[128], Float:pos[3];
GetPlayerPos(playerid,pos[0],pos[1],pos[2]);
mysql_format(mysql,query,sizeof(query),"UPDATE `comptejoueurs` SET `Admin`=%d, `Vip`=%d, `Argent`=%d, `PositionX`=%f, `PositionY`=%f, `PositionZ`=%f WHERE `ID`=%d",\
InfoJoueur[playerid][Admin],InfoJoueur[playerid][Vip],InfoJoueur[playerid][Argent],pos[0],pos[1],pos[2], InfoJoueur[playerid][ID]);
mysql_tquery(mysql,query);
printf("%s",query);
Re: Mysql R39-2 Don't save -
zPain - 01.02.2015
I think the array size isn't enough.
pawn Код:
new query[0xFF], Float:pos[3];
GetPlayerPos(playerid,pos[0],pos[1],pos[2]);
mysql_format(mysql, query, sizeof(query),"UPDATE `comptejoueurs` SET `Admin`=%d, `Vip`=%d, `Argent`=%d, `PositionX`=%f, `PositionY`=%f, `PositionZ`=%f WHERE `ID`=%d",
InfoJoueur[playerid][Admin],
InfoJoueur[playerid][Vip],
InfoJoueur[playerid][Argent],
pos[0],pos[1],pos[2],
InfoJoueur[playerid][ID]
);
mysql_tquery(mysql,query,"","");
printf("%s",query);